      The Architect of Modernity: The Visionary Legacy of Habib Rahman In the grand tapestry of post-independence Indian history, few figures have shaped the physical landscape of the nation as profoundly or as elegantly as Habib Rahman. Born in 1915 in the vibrant, culturally rich atmosphere of Kolkata, Rahman was a man whose life and work served as a bridge between two worlds.
